TB-500 is a synthetic peptide containing a specific short sequence that replicates the active, functional domain of endogenous Thymosin Beta-4, a major actin-sequestering protein found naturally in human and animal tissues.
This low-molecular-weight structural design allows the peptide to move efficiently across cellular membranes in experimental environments. The compound interacts directly with G-actin subunits, which triggers downstream intracellular signaling cascades and blocks actin polymerization. As a result, the compound acts as an essential reference standard for investigators mapping endothelial cell migration, dermal wound healing kinetics, and localized angiogenic dynamics inside isolated tissues. 🔬 Technical Specifications & Chemical Profile
- Compound Name: TB-500
- Alternative Names: Thymosin Beta-4 Fragment, Ac-LKKTETQ, Thymosin β-4 synthetic
- Active Concentration: 5mg per vial
- Sequence Structure: Ac-Leu-Lys-Lys-Thr-Glu-Thr-Gln
- Physical Form: Lyophilized (freeze-dried) sterile white crystalline powder
- Purity Level: ≥99% verified via High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) and Mass Spectrometry (MS)
- Molecular Formula: C₃₈H₆₈N₁₀O₁₄
- Molecular Weight: 889.01 g/mol

📦 Storage and Stability Standards
To protect the delicate peptide bonds and ensure reproducible experimental data, proper laboratory handling protocols must be maintained. The lyophilized powder should be stored at -20°C for standard lab workflows up to 12 months. For long-term compound archives, it is highly recommended to preserve the vials at -80°C. The compound must be kept completely isolated from moisture, humidity, and direct UV light exposure because sudden environmental fluctuations can induce rapid molecular decay and destabilize the protein structure.
